June 07, 2012
To accommodate the road widening on Davis Drive, hydro crews will soon start work to relocate hydro poles farther back from the roadway. Starting in June, new supportive bases, followed by new concrete poles will be installed along Davis Drive.

Note: Going forward, hydro crews will be working in the boulevards and lands acquired by York Region.
Note: Old wooden hydro poles (currently housing telecommunication wires) will be cut just above the wires and remain in place until telecommunications services are relocated into the new underground duct bank.
The concrete bases will support 150 new hydro poles placed approximately 55 metres apart.
The new concrete hydro poles are 19.8 metres tall, have a decorative black finish, an overhead street light and do not require supportive wires.
